just replaced my ign module in my boat. ran a half a tank of gas thru it and my module went out today? why so soon? it was oem replacement also. 1984 454 330 hp thunderbolt iv
#2
Bad grounding somewhere in the circuit or a bad coil drawing too much current through the module.

+1
and if its mounted to your exhaust manifold riser,,it will over heat it if theirs not enough water going through the riser to keep it cool..manifolds and or risers could be all rusted up inside keeping it from cooling..

Check the ground between the distributor and the intake also, this can cause issues. Use an ohmmeter between the dist and the block, not the intake manifold.
